terosaur lower jaw eroding on the surface. Note the large teeth, one of the characteristics of Hamipterus tianshanensis. This material relates to a paper that appeared in the Dec. 1, 2017, issue of Science, published by AAAS. The paper, by X. Wang at Chinese Academy of Sciences in Beijing, China, and colleagues was titled, "Egg accumulation with 3-D embryos provides insight into the life history of a pterosaur."
